Wisconsin Attorney General Josh Kaul says police shot and killed a student outside a middle school after receiving a report of someone with a weapon. He said no one else was hurt and the student didn't get inside the building. Kaul spoke Wednesday evening at the first law enforcement briefing on an incident that sent children fleeing amid gunshots earlier in the day. Authorities in Mount Horeb had previously said an active shooter who never got inside was “neutralized” outside the district’s middle school building Wednesday. Kaul said that while police used deadly force, he didn't say how many officers fired weapons or whether the student had fired a weapon.

Tensions are growing on the UCLA campus as law enforcement officers order a large group of pro-Palestinian demonstrators to disperse. The heavy police presence comes as administrators and campus police are facing intense criticism for failing to act quickly to stop an overnight attack on a pro-Palestinian encampment on campus by counter-demonstrators. Supporters of the encampment including other students and alumni are largely staying put on the campus steps as they listen to speakers and engage in chants. Students are gathered again in the encampment after reconstructing barricades. Elsewhere police have dismantled at encampment at Dartmouth College in New Hampshire and activists clashed with police at the University of Wisconsin, Madison.

Authorities say a section of a highway in southern China's Guangdong province has collapsed, killing at least 36 people. The disaster occurred early Wednesday after heavy rains in recent days. A Meizhou city government statement said that 23 cars fell down a slope after a long section of the roadway collapsed. Witnesses told local media they heard a loud noise and saw a hole open up several meters wide behind them after driving past the road section just before it collapsed. Video and photos in local media showed smoke and fire at the scene, with highway rails slanting down into the flames.

U.S. Secretary of State Antony Blinken has met with Israeli leaders in his push for a cease-fire deal between Israel and Hamas to impress on them that “the time is now" for an agreement that would free hostages and bring a pause in the nearly seven months of war. The current round of talks appears to be serious, with Hamas considering a new proposal. But the sides remain far apart on the key issue of whether the war should end as part of an emerging deal. In talks with Blinken,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u repeated his determination to carry out an offensive on the southern Gaza town of Rafah, where more than a million Palestinians are sheltering.
